Psalm 33:11 – The Lord’s will stands fast forever, and the designs of his heart from age to age.
God’s economy and mystery are difficult for the human mind to grasp; yet, still they are what they are, an eternal, inscrutable plan. We humans struggle, we reach for our potential, and we find it only through Christ. We make our own plans only to see that God has a better design. We plan for a day, a month, a year. God plans for eternity. God’s design is here and now. God’s design is always, for God plans from a heart that is good and whole and full.
God says: Just because you say you cannot see me does not mean that I am not with you. Just because you believe you cannot hear me does mean that I do not speak. Just because you feel alone does not mean that I do not carry you through the peril of your days. I love you still, no matter what you have done or not done. I love you always, no matter who you are or who you are not. I love you enough to have created you, to watch over you, to save you, to free you. For now and forever.
